Re: [PATCH v2 4/5] iio: max597x: Add support for max597x

From: kernel test robot
Date: Thu Jul 07 2022 - 10:38:56 EST


Hi Naresh,

Thank you for the patch! Yet something to improve:

686 config MAX597X_IIO
687 tristate "Maxim 597x power switch and monitor"
688 depends on I2C
689 depends on OF
690 depends MFD_MAX597X
> 691 help
692 This driver exposes Maxim 5970/5978 voltage/current monitoring
693 interface using iio framework.
